310762719_174097598533869_2015889089625884380_nlow.jpgHow to Replace the Replacement Key Battery For the Saab 9-3

Saab owners have a unique procedure to add an additional key. This requires the use of a handheld computer, known as Tech-2 which is to be used by the dealer. Then a new car key and transponder have to be purchased and then programmed to the car.

Replacement Case

As opposed to the traditional Saab keys of old keys, the new key fobs are equipped with electronics which makes it hard to duplicate. This has made theft of cars much more difficult than it was just a few years ago. However, it has made the replacement of lost keys an incredibly expensive task.

Every owner of a saab key fob replacement 9-3 needs to have at least two working keys. It is expensive to replace a lost key because it requires replacing the CIM module, as well as reprogramming the locking cylinders. Dealers usually charge between $100 and $200 for this.

There are several ways to get around the high price. Some parts retailers will look up the code from an old key (usually the same one that opens the doors and switches the ignition) and cut a new key blade from metal for less than the dealer's cost. The key must be exactly the identical to the original one for it to function in your vehicle.

You can also change the case yourself by following these steps. You'll need an open-faced screwdriver and a lot of patience. With the screwdriver you can pull apart the plastic and remove the emergency key. Once you have the case open, take the electronics out and place them inside the new case. Be sure to put the correct key and badge back into the case as well.

Replacement Battery

The Saab 9-3 replacement battery is a budget part that can be easily and quickly replaced. This YouTube video by Cyclone Cyd demonstrates the procedure for replacing the remote fob battery with just four easy steps. This tutorial can be used for any modern saab key fob repair key fob, however the procedure might differ slightly.

This button is usually located next to the saab 900 key logo on the back of the fob. It's usually near the saab replacement key logo on the back of the fob. Use a flathead screwdriver to insert the screwdriver into the small hole on this button. This should be sufficient to let the fob case open so that you can replace the battery.

After the new battery CR1632 is installed You can then reassemble the remote key fob, and then program it to your car. The procedure should take no more than an hour, if not less. This is a very easy procedure that doesn't require special tools.

If you lose your key, the process is more complicated, but it can still be done. The dealer has to first verify the VIN of the vehicle, and then purchase a replacement TWICE module and key blade with the proper unique code. The dealer will then need to program the key using MDI, a new software tool.

Key Replacement Fob

The key fob is the device that locks and unlocks your car, it's got a battery within. They have a limited life span and will eventually fail. This is a regular issue that occurs with all vehicles, and the good news is that you can change the batteries in many fobs, without replacing the whole case. You can purchase replacement fobs from Amazon that include all the electronics already installed, which means you can simply open the case and replace the batteries in the original case. You'll need to take out the emergency key before you can replace the batteries. To do this, insert a small flathead screwsdriver into the slot in the middle. The case will split as you rotate the screwdriver around it.

If you're looking to replace your keys, keep a spare on hand. This will save you a significant amount of money. If you have a spare you can request that the dealer cut an additional key and program it to the car, which is much cheaper than replacing the whole key fob.

If you do not have a spare key one, you can add another key to your car, however this will require a lot of research and effort. The cost of adding a second key is around a hundred dollars and it requires programming of the car's computer. Professionals can accomplish this but it's not a cheap option.

Replacement Ignition

As opposed to earlier Saab cars, the modern saab car keys 9-3 models feature an advanced alarm system that is built around a coded key. This means that should you lose only one working key, acquiring another one could be very expensive because the car needs to have a specific computer module installed and it must also be programmed to accept a new key. The majority of locksmiths aren't able to do this and dealers will charge hundred dollars to program the new key!

Dealers will charge you a premium to replace your car computer (also known as the CIM or SAAB twice) If you lose your only working key.
